Bac Ninh develops strategic spatial planning with 2 key areas and 5 development corridors

26/10/2024 09:52

(BNP) - According to Decision No. 1589/QD-TTg on approving the Bac Ninh provincial planning for the 2021-2030 period, with a vision to 2050, Bac Ninh will build dynamic regions based on the development of strategic spatial planning with 2 key regions and 5 development corridors.

Accordingly, the spatial arrangement plan for the development of dynamic economic zones includes the following administrative units: Bac Ninh city, Tu Son city, Tien Du district, Yen Phong district, Que Vo town and Thuan Thanh town. Among which, the central urban area of ​​the dynamic zone is Bac Ninh city, which is a multi-sector, multi-field service development urban area that serves as the province’s political - administrative, economic, cultural, medical, educational, scientific and technical center of the province; it is an urban area with comprehensive and sustainable development in industry, trade, services and finance.

Regarding infrastructure and urban areas, the province focuses on upgrading, developing, and modernizing transportation infrastructure, trade, service, logistics, and digital infrastructure to serve the development of digital government, digital economy, digital society, and industrial park infrastructure associated with urbanization.

Bac Ninh province develops a strategic spatial plan outlining 2 key areas and 5 development corridors. According to the province's growth orientation of becoming a centrally-run city, the urban structure is divided into 2 areas including an inner-city area to the north of the Duong river and a suburban area to the south of the Duong river. Bac Ninh has 1 central urban area of ​​Bac Ninh (inner-city area includes the administrative boundaries of Bac Ninh city, Tu Son city, Tien Du district, Que Vo town and Yen Phong district) developed according to the multi-functional urban cluster structure model, 1 suburban area with a satellite city (Thuan Thanh town), and the Industrial - Service - Agricultural development area is Gia Binh and Luong Tai districts.

The spatial structure is a combination of the radial network structure and 5 development corridors, including: The urban - commercial - service connection corridor along National Highway 1A, which connects Tu Son - Tien Du - Bac Ninh, combined with the urban development axis of Hanoi - Bac Ninh - Bac Giang. The corridor will focus on 3 existing urban areas: Tu Son, Tien Du, Bac Ninh, which will be limited by green wedges.

Along National Highway 18, there is a service-industry-trade connection corridor that connects Yen Phong, Bac Ninh, and Que Vo, as well as urban centers connected with concentrated industrial parks and service infrastructure to support industrial park operations.

Ecological corridors along Duong and Cau rivers; arranging social infrastructure works, urban technical infrastructure with low density, prioritizing the development of trees, landscapes, and water surfaces along river corridors; planning areas for high-tech agricultural development in Que Vo town, Yen Phong district, and Tien Du district.

Corridor for urban, industrial and high-tech ecological agricultural development along National Highway 17, which connects Que Vo - Gia Binh - Luong Tai - Thuan Thanh.

Urban service development corridor along National Highway 38 and Ring Road 4 of the Capital region; spiritual cultural tourism corridor connecting Tu Son city, Tien Du district and Thuan Thanh town along Provincial Road 276.
